Interesting paper. While I wonder how easy it is find suiteable routes for DoSing LN in practice I guess we'll see soon enough now that this paper has been released.

It's also always nice to see a paper that ends with proposed solutions that do not include an attempt to push a new pre-mined alt coin. Also mitigation seems to be mostly tweaking some parameters with existing LN implementations and safeguards that seem relatively straight-forward to implement -- eg. loop avoidance, as mentioned in the paper -- so we're not utterly doomed yet. It goes to show that we're still in early stages though.
